dc.description.abstract Purpose: The Global Entrepreneurship Monitor Project (GEM Project) is one of entrepreneurship studies' most influential research initiatives. This project systematically evaluates both "Entrepreneurship Activity" and the "Entrepreneurial Framework Conditions" across diverse economies, providing valuable insights into entrepreneurial dynamics on a global scale. Established two and half decades ago, the GEM Project has produced a significant dataset that captures the nuances of entrepreneurial phenomena within the country. This paper makes use of the GEM India Study database. It explores the entrepreneurial ecosystem in India with a broad aim: to promote entrepreneurial activity. en_US
